Output 4707da64a17923d5988bbd56aea28fb421230f001c09a7ee16c6fdce0659330e: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d3b72229193467581fe523618abc7b662e0c0b7 OP_EQUAL
address
3D7BbtghWya5gh7hQaVz1SVpep1897LRyu
transaction
4707da64a17923d5988bbd56aea28fb421230f001c09a7ee16c6fdce0659330e
confirmations
347797
spent
true